Create an Account WebHands down the best place to sell you Yu-Gi-Oh cards is on ebay. Ebay is an online marketplace where you can sell almost anything. You will be able to get the most value of your cards using ebay due to the sheer fact that its a well known marketplace for trading card enthusiasts. Another place to sell Yu-Gi-Oh cards is at Yu-Gi-Oh tournaments.

Buy lists will give you access to reputable … gas reading stickWebMar 24, 2024 · Checking the Text. 1. Look at the font of the text. If you have a card you’re suspicious of, compare its text to a real card to see if there are differences. If you don’t have a card on hand, look up a genuine card online. Bootleg or fake Yu Gi Oh! cards often have a different font than the real deals. david le batard twitter
